import json
import time
from neteria.client import NeteriaClient
if __name__ == "__main__":
# Create a client instance.
client = NeteriaClient()
client.listen()
# Discover a Neteria Server.
print "Discovering Neteria servers..."
while not client.registered:
client.autodiscover()
time.sleep(1)
print "Connected!"
# Send data to the server.
exit_cmds = ['quit', 'exit']
data = None
while data not in exit_cmds:
try:
data = str(raw_input("> "))
data = json.loads(data)
except Exception as e:
print("Error decoding client command: %s" % str(e))
data = ""
if data:
client.event(data)
